that looks pretty phat too. behind the seat would be a good place if you had a reat seat delete or something. what does the digital box do so different that the regualr 6al?

No pills required!

Dial adjust for:

-Max Rev
-2-Step Rev Limiter
-Start Timing Retard
-Switched Timing Retard (PERFECT for NITROUS)

I put it BEHIND the seat b/c its right there to adjust. I just open the door and dial in more timing or different RPMs on the limiters. I don't have to unlock, then pop the hood, and work around a hot engine....Oh...and it looks trick.
